A varied linear walk from Brockenhurst to Lymington via an Iron Age Fort. From the village of Brockenhurst, this walk passes through Roydon Woods Nature Reserve over Setley Plain and onto Buckland Rings, the site of a former Iron Age hill fort near Lymington.

Lymington Town Quay

Highlight • Viewpoint

The Isle of Wight is accessible from Lymington with a ferry to Yarmouth. Sailing has a rich history in this seaside town, which continues today with events such as the Royal Lymington Cup.
